Summary of Bill HR 4092
The bill titled "To amend the Immigration and Nationality Act to provide that aliens who have been convicted of or who have committed certain offenses involving interstate or foreign shipments by carrier are inadmissible and deportable" was introduced in the 119th Congress on June 24, 2025, as H.R. 4092.

Current Status of Bill HR 4092
Bill HR 4092 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since June 24, 2025. Bill HR 4092 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on June 24, 2025. Bill HR 4092's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on the Judiciary. as of June 24, 2025
